Question:
What is TPU filament and what are its key characteristics?
Answer: TPU filament, made from thermoplastic polyurethane, is widely used in 3D printing for its remarkable flexibility and resilience. Key characteristics include an 85A durometer rating, indicating medium to low hardness, which allows for the creation of soft, pliable parts. The filament is also highly resistant to abrasion, oil, and chemicals. These properties make it ideal for applications requiring parts that can bend without breaking, such as phone cases, footwear components, and custom gaskets. -

Question:
Is TPU filament difficult to print with?
Answer: While TPU filament can be more challenging to print than standard filaments, it can yield great results with the right setup. Adjusting your printer settings, such as a slower print speed, reduced retraction, and optimized temperature, can significantly enhance print quality. It's essential to use a direct drive extruder or a well-calibrated setup to avoid common printing issues like clogging. Users often find success in projects requiring flexible materials once they master the nuances of printing with TPU. -
Question:
What settings should I use when printing with 85A TPU filament?
Answer: When printing with 85A TPU filament, it's crucial to set your 3D printer to specific parameters for optimal results. A nozzle temperature around 220 to 240 degrees Celsius works best, while the print speed should be slower, typically between 20-40 mm/s. Using a heated bed at approximately 60 degrees Celsius can also prevent warping. These settings help ensure your prints adhere well to the build surface, reducing the likelihood of print failures and enhancing the final product's quality. -

How should I store TPU filament to maintain its quality?
Answer: To maintain the quality of TPU filament, it's vital to store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Using airtight containers or desiccant packs can help prevent moisture absorption, which can lead to printing defects. Ensuring that the filament remains dust-free will also enhance its usability. Proper storage conditions not only extend the life of your filament but also improve print quality for your 3D projects. -

Features & Benefits
- Thermoplastic polyurethane elastomer with medium-low hardness and high resilience.
- Excellent elasticity and printability for short-range 3D printers.
- High elongation and impact strength for durable printed parts.
- Maintains flexibility down to -50°C, perfect for cold environments.
- High adhesion to platforms using glass and PC materials.
- Multifunctional with exceptional abrasion, tear, and solvent resistance.
